Lyons Ranch Trail is a 6-mile out-and-back in Redwood National and State Parks near Waseck, CA. It climbs 1,041 ft. It scores 89/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: genuinely wild.

  1. Start at the trailhead, heading W.
  2. 0.7 miSharp left, heading SE.
  3. 0.3 miTurn right, heading W.
  4. 1.4 miContinue straight onto Lyons Ranch Trail, heading SW.
  5. 0.7 miReach Lyons Ranch Trail, then turn around and head back the way you came.
  6. 2 miTurn left, heading SE.
  7. 0.3 miSharp right, heading NW.
  8. 0.6 miArrive back at the trailhead.

Each distance is the walk from the previous step. Tap a step for a map of its junction.
